Typical Casio Price Ranges by Category
1) Basic and School Scientific Calculators
- Common models: fx-82MS, fx-85MS
- Typical price: $8–$18
- Best for: middle school, high school, everyday math
2) Advanced Scientific Calculators
- Common models: fx-991ES Plus, fx-991CW
- Typical price: $20–$45
- Best for: algebra, trigonometry, engineering basics, exam prep
3) Graphing Calculators
- Common models: fx-9750GIII, fx-CG50
- Typical price: $60–$140
- Best for: advanced high school math, calculus, STEM coursework
4) Financial Calculators
- Common models: FC-100V, FC-200V
- Typical price: $35–$70
- Best for: business students, accounting, TVM and cash-flow analysis
What Affects Casio Calculator Prices?
Even for the same model number, prices can differ significantly across stores. Here are the biggest pricing factors:
- Region and currency: Prices in the US, UK, India, and Southeast Asia can vary due to taxes/import duties.
- Seller type: Authorized dealers may charge more than marketplace sellers, but usually offer stronger warranty support.
- School season: Back-to-school months often increase demand and can push prices up.
- Exam approval: Models approved for local exams may sell at a premium near exam periods.
- Bundle offers: Cases, batteries, and learning guides can make one listing look expensive while offering better value.
How to Get the Best Casio Calculator Price
Compare by exact model code
Always compare price using the exact code (for example, fx-991CW vs fx-991ES Plus). Similar names can hide feature and price differences.
Check total cost, not sticker price
A low listed price may become expensive after tax and shipping. That is why the estimator above includes discount, coupon, tax, and delivery cost.
Watch seasonal promotions
Major discounts often appear during:
- Back-to-school campaigns
- Black Friday / Cyber Monday
- Year-end clearance sales
Consider last-generation models
If your course does not require the newest interface, older models can save money while still delivering reliable performance.
